WebSep 15, 2024 · Employee Furlough – What is a Furlough? Firstly, it’s important to understand exactly what furlough is. In a nutshell, it means “temporary layoff from work”. It is a mandatory suspension from work. Normally furlough is without pay and can be as brief or as long as the employer or government requires. Military. a vacation or leave of absence granted to an enlisted person. a usually temporary layoff from work: Many plant workers have been forced to go on furlough. a … WebJan 30, 2024 · A furlough is when employees are given a leave of absence from work for which the employee is not paid. A worker who is on furlough remains an employee of the company where they work. They receive neither a salary nor a reduced salary.
